[PATCH] D88798: [flang] Fix heap overflow in Real formatting.

Meinersbur updated this revision to Diff 298046.
Meinersbur added a comment.

Copy integer part-wise instead of memcpy. memcpy/reinterpret_cast assumed platform endianess.

Index: flang/lib/Evaluate/real.cpp
===================================================================
--- flang/lib/Evaluate/real.cpp
+++ flang/lib/Evaluate/real.cpp
@@ -496,14 +496,25 @@
     }
   } else {
     using B = decimal::BinaryFloatingPointNumber<P>;
-    const auto *value{reinterpret_cast<const B *>(this)};
+    constexpr static const auto bits{word_.bits};
+    typename B::RawType b = word_.ToUInt64();
+    if constexpr (bits > 64) {
+      auto d{word_};
+      for (int i{64}; i < bits; i += 64) {
+        d = d.SHIFTR(64);
+        const typename B::RawType l{d.ToUInt64()};
+        b |= (l << i);
+      }
+    }
+    B value{b};
+
     char buffer[24000]; // accommodate real*16
     decimal::DecimalConversionFlags flags{}; // default: exact representation
     if (minimal) {
       flags = decimal::Minimize;
     }
     auto result{decimal::ConvertToDecimal<P>(buffer, sizeof buffer, flags,
-        static_cast<int>(sizeof buffer), decimal::RoundNearest, *value)};
+        static_cast<int>(sizeof buffer), decimal::RoundNearest, value)};
     const char *p{result.str};
     if (DEREF(p) == '-' || *p == '+') {
       o << *p++;
